Lockheed Martin Launches Smart Grid Command and Control Software Suite
Lockheed Martin launched its Smart Energy Enterprise Suite, or SEEsuite™, of
advanced grid management applications to give utilities, system operators and
defense customers unprecedented insight into their enterprise operations and
command and control of their smart grid assets.
SEEsuite combines Lockheed Martin's expertise in systems-of-systems integration,
service oriented architectures, cyber security and mission-critical systems
development with utility-specific functionality. SEEsuite helps customers
dynamically manage load during times of grid stress or volatile market prices,
integrate and balance load from distributed energy resources, increase
situational awareness for advanced decision making, and deploy and manage 'microgrids'
– portions of the electric grid able to operate independently of the overall
grid.

SEEsuite applications include: SEEload™ for Distributed Energy Resource
Management, SEEview™ for Smart Grid Situational Awareness and SEEgrid™ for
Integrated Grid Management.
SEEload enables utilities and system operators to precisely and easily manage
demand response events across an entire distribution network, including
individual substations and circuits. SEEload also manages distributed energy
resources including electric vehicles and energy storage devices to give
utilities greater control over peak load and distributed energy resources.
SEEview integrates key operational and business systems to provide customers
near real time situational awareness across generation, transmission,
distribution, and customer systems. SEEview allows utilities' key decision
makers to sense and respond quickly to changing market conditions, grid
disturbances, and unplanned changes to their generation mix.
SEEgrid enables utilities to optimize the utilization of distributed energy
resources to improve grid reliability, meet renewable energy and emissions
targets, and reduce the cost of delivered electricity. SEEgrid also allows
defense customers to effectively go 'off-grid' for enhanced energy security
during times of natural or man-made disasters.
